There's a martial art form called muay thai, also known as thai kick boxing, that has primarily kicking and punching moves. This martial art is regarded as a standing sport where opponents fight until one of them falls to the ground. The popular full contact sport, kickboxing, initially made its appearance in the 1960s. Boxing has been in existence since 688 B.C. and it's a sport where you are only permitted to make use of your hands, and you try to knock out your challenger. Even though boxing is excellent if you are in close quarters, it is rather limited when compared with other martial arts.
Another discipline of mixed martial art which is close quarter is Judo. You have to grab your adversary and throw him to the ground, as opposed to punching or kicking. If you cannot do this, then a grappling move can be used to immobilize the other fighter. Wrestling is similar to judo, since winning a match with your competition is dependent upon your ability to use leverage, clinches, holds and locks. Competitors are forced into submission in jujitsu with the use of choke holds and locks, as it concentrates on grappling and ground fighting.
